    • There are two things to immediately clarify. Firstly, why did court papers go to the wrong address?  In 99% of backdoor CCJ cases here the person moves and doesn't update the vehicle log book address.  Or they move and they don't inform the parties who they are in legal dispute with of the new address.  Does either of these apply to you? Secondly, given this has been going on for over three years without presumably any ill effects on you, how important is it for you to have a clean credit file?  I ask as, if you do absolutely nothing, the CCJ will disappear in April 2027.

    • We have finally managed to obtain the transcript of this case.

      The judge's reasoning is very useful and will certainly be helpful in any other cases relating to third-party rights where the customer has contracted with the courier company by using a broker.
      This is generally speaking the problem with using PackLink who are domiciled in Spain and very conveniently out of reach of the British justice system.

      Frankly I don't think that is any accident.

      One of the points that the judge made was that the customers contract with the broker specifically refers to the courier – and it is clear that the courier knows that they are acting for a third party. There is no need to name the third party. They just have to be recognisably part of a class of person – such as a sender or a recipient of the parcel.

      Please note that a recent case against UPS failed on exactly the same issue with the judge held that the Contracts (Rights of Third Parties) Act 1999 did not apply.

Hi, i started work this evening at 18:00 and came straight to this web site as it is now time to set up court action for several companies. It is now 02:40 and i still have no clue!!! Please help

 

Im lost,

a: How do i calculate the intrest?

b: Do i have to claim the intrest?

c: do i have to notify abbey etc.. of the change of ammount that i am appling for as it now includes the intrest?

d: Do i just go onto the moneyclaim web site and set up the court date there? if so, do i have to send out any other letters to anyone i.e the courts or abbey?

c: Once completed the form on moneyclaim is there any thing eles that i need to do?

 

I have sent many letters asking for repayment and have only received goodwill gestures, i sent them another letter summerising what i wanted refunded minusing their repayments of goodwill gestures that i accepted with the new total and explained that they can expect a letter in a few days from the courts with a date to attend. I have followed all the steps but now have gotten lost. Is there much point in me asking for the intrest to be refunded? Would it look better in court if i was only to ask for what i am owed without the intrest?

 

Any info would be gratefully appreciated

Becky x :confused:

==========================================================

 

a. There are a variety of different spreadsheets on the template forums, Simply fill in the dates and amounts of charges and it automatically calculates the interest. The county court allows you to claim 8% from the date of the charge. There is a large movement towards claiming the Contractural rate of interest which can be up to 30%. There are lots of threads on this and will need some research on your part before you go down this line

 

b. No you dont but why wouldnt you they have had your money !!!

 

c. No the Court automatically add the interest you have included on your claim form when they send it to the bank

 

d. No its all done for you. A court date will only be set for your local court when the bank have notified their intention to defend and both parties have completed the allocation questionaire which will be sent to your by the court

 

e. Keep logging on to the web site it gives you an update if the bank have replied. If the judgement button is available 28 days after the service date you can apply for a judgement on line.
